Changeset 5587 for debian

Show
Ignore:
Timestamp:
07/14/05 11:34:03 (3 years ago)
Author:
rafl
svk:copy_cache_prev:
7591
Message:

* Improved the Debian package:

  • Moved architecture independent modules to pugs-modules
  • Closed the ITP bug with the changelog
  • Clean up properly in clean rule
Location:
debian
Files:
4 modified

Legend:

Unmodified
Added
Removed
  • debian/changelog

    r5431 r5587  
    11pugs (6.2.8-1) unstable; urgency=low 
    22 
    3   * Initial release. 
     3  * Initial release (Closes: #297871). 
    44 
    55 -- Florian Ragwitz <florian@mookooh.org>  Wed,  6 Jul 2005 05:14:39 +0200 
  • debian/control

    r5432 r5587  
    33Priority: optional 
    44Maintainer: Florian Ragwitz <florian@mookooh.org> 
    5 Build-Depends: debhelper (>= 4.0.0), ghc, perl 
     5Build-Depends: debhelper (>= 4.0.0), ghc6, perl 
    66Standards-Version: 3.6.2 
    77 
    88Package: pugs 
    99Architecture: any 
    10 Depends: ${shlibs:Depends} 
     10Depends: ${shlibs:Depends}, pugs-modules (>= ${Source-Version}) 
    1111Description: A Perl 6 Implementation 
    1212 Pugs is an implementation of Perl 6, written in Haskell. It aims to implement 
     
    2626 . 
    2727 This package contains various documentation for pugs. 
     28 
     29Package: pugs-modules 
     30Architecture: all 
     31Depends: pugs (>= ${Source-Version}) 
     32Description: Pugs core modules 
     33 Pugs is an implementation of Perl 6, written in Haskell. It aims to implement 
     34 the full Perl 6 specification, as detailed in the Synopses at 
     35 http://dev.perl.org/perl6/synopsis/ 
     36 . 
     37 Homepage: http://pugscode.org/ 
     38 . 
     39 This package contains architecture independent pugs modules. 
  • debian/pugs.install

    r5257 r5587  
    11usr/share/vim/* 
    2 usr/share/perl5/* 
    3 usr/share/perl6/* 
    42usr/lib/perl6/* 
    53usr/bin/* 
  • debian/rules

    r5532 r5587  
    3232        dh_testdir 
    3333        dh_testroot 
    34         rm -f build-arch-stamp build-indep-stamp configure-stamp debian/pugs.1 debian/pugscc.1 
     34        rm -f build-arch-stamp build-indep-stamp configure-stamp debian/pugs.1 debian/pugscc.1 src/Pugs/CodeGen/PIR/Prelude.hi src/Pugs/CodeGen/PIR/Prelude.o ext/Test-Builder/destroy_test.p6 
    3535        -$(MAKE) realclean 
    3636        dh_clean 
     
    4141        dh_testroot 
    4242        dh_installdirs 
     43        dh_install -i --sourcedir=$(CURDIR)/debian/tmp 
    4344        cp -r $(CURDIR)/docs/* $(CURDIR)/debian/pugs-doc/usr/share/doc/pugs-doc/ 
    4445        rm -f $(CURDIR)/debian/pugs-doc/usr/share/doc/pugs-doc/SEEALSO